Job Information for: outside parts consultant hvac

Job Industry: hvac

Description: An outside parts consultant in the HVAC industry is responsible for providing expert advice and support to customers in selecting appropriate parts for their he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ems. They work closely with clients to understand their specific requirements and recommend the best parts that meet their needs. This involves analyzing technical specifications, reviewing product catalogs, and staying updated on the latest industry trends. Outside parts consultants also assist in troubleshooting and resolving issues related to HVAC systems, ensuring customer satisfaction.
